POWER/Google Women Tech Founders Program 2022 for MENA women tech entrepreneurs – Apply Now

Spread the love

The U.S. Department of State, through the Providing Opportunities for Women’s Economic Rise (POWER) Initiative, has partnered with Google’s Women Techmakers to host the Women Tech Founders Program.

This virtual program will provide women tech entrepreneurs from across the Middle East and North Africa start-up training from Google’s tech and start up experts and help build a network of future tech changemakers in the region.

This 7-week development program, aims to empower 50 women founders who are building tech startups in the Middle East and North Africa region by giving them access to startup related training by Google, networking and mentorship. The program will run virtually.

Application Criteria:
Applicant must be a woman leading a tech startup with
A technology-based product
At least acquired seed funding
Some level of market traction with their product/service
Legally registered in the Middle East and North Africa region

Selection Criteria

  • Program finalists will be selected through a competitive application process that will be open from April 4 to April 30, 2022, with the first program session held on June 7, 2022.

Requirements

  • The program is targeting women who have launched a tech business within the last two years or are launching a new tech business with acquired seed funding.
  • All program sessions will be virtual and will be conducted in English.

Benefits

  • Fifty finalists will receive training on both tech and business development concepts with the opportunity to gain insights and mentorship from Google’s experts.
  • Sessions will be tailored to participants’ skillsets to enable them to leverage technology to expand their businesses.
  • Interspersed between technical sessions will be community building sessions that allow participants to network and collaborate with other leading women in tech in the region, as well as the United States, and U.S. government officials.
